TransSubscription.Reinitialize Metode

Definisi

Menandai langganan untuk reinisialisasi.

Overload

Reinitialize()

Menandai langganan untuk diinisialisasi ulang kali berikutnya Agen Distribusi berjalan untuk menyinkronkan langganan.

Reinitialize(Boolean)

Menginisialisasi ulang langganan.

Reinitialize()

Menandai langganan untuk diinisialisasi ulang kali berikutnya Agen Distribusi berjalan untuk menyinkronkan langganan.

public:
 void Reinitialize();
public void Reinitialize ();
member this.Reinitialize : unit -> unit
Public Sub Reinitialize ()

Keterangan

Setelah memanggil Reinitialize metode , Anda harus mulai menyinkronkan untuk menginisialisasi ulang langganan. Untuk informasi selengkapnya, lihat Cara: Menginisialisasi ulang Langganan (Pemrograman RMO).

Anda harus memanggil CommitPropertyChanges untuk menyimpan perubahan apa pun pada TransSubscription objek di server sebelum memanggil Reinitialize.

Metode Reinitialize ini hanya dapat dipanggil oleh anggota sysadmin peran server tetap di Penerbit (atau di Distributor untuk Penerbit non-SQL Server), oleh anggota db_owner peran database tetap pada database publikasi (atau pada database distribusi untuk Penerbit non-SQL Server), atau pengguna yang membuat langganan.

Reinitialize Panggilan setara dengan menjalankan sp_reinitsubscription (Transact-SQL).

Berlaku untuk

Reinitialize(Boolean)

Menginisialisasi ulang langganan.

public:
 void Reinitialize(bool invalidateSnapshot);
public void Reinitialize (bool invalidateSnapshot);
member this.Reinitialize : bool -> unit
Public Sub Reinitialize (invalidateSnapshot As Boolean)

Parameter

invalidateSnapshot
Boolean

Menunjukkan apakah akan membatalkan rekam jepret.

Berlaku untuk